如何解决Netscaler响应者策略以重定向URL
我正在尝试设置netscaler以使用正则表达式来处理URL重定向,我的要求是将所有不包含URL中国家的请求都重定向到基于客户端IP的国家。
例如:假设客户正在从英国浏览网站,https://example.com/main
将被重定向到https://example.com/uk/main
通过策略配置,我能够使重定向仅对基本URL有效,而对整个请求无效,如下所示:
HTTP.REQ.URL.EQ("/") && CLIENT.IP.SRC.MATCHES_LOCATION("*.UK.*.*.*.*")
这只会将用户从https://example.com
重定向到https://example.com/uk/
,而不是从(例如)https://example.com/main
重定向到https://example.com/uk/main
有什么想法可以使用RegEx实现吗?例如,如果不包含https://example.com/*/(any two letters)/*
,我可以应用它吗?如果不是,则可以重定向?
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。